To err is human and to forgive divine, according to the old adage. Humans who forgive are(1)______to experience significant physical and (2)______ health benefits from doing so. Now researchers report that these(3)______ health effects appear to(4)______by age, along with the willingness to forgive others and the willingness to forgive (5)______. "Taken together, our findings emphasize that forgiveness is a multidimensional(6)______" , write study lead author Dr. Loren L. Toussaint of the University of Michigan and his colleagues. " There are age differences in some(7) ______of forgiveness and in their (8)______to health. "
Their conclusions are based on survey(9)______from more than 1 ,100 adults during a 5-month study period.(10)______, young adults (18-44 years)reported that they were less(11)______ to forgive others than middle-aged(15-64)and older adults(65 and older).
Among survey participants of all ages,(12)______, reports of forgiveness of themselves and others were(13)______with decreased psychological distress, including feelings of restlessness, hopelessness and nervousness.(14)______, young adults who reported high levels of self-forgiveness were more likely to be satisfied with their lives,(15)______ middle age and older adults who reported high levels of forgiveness of others were more likely to report(16)______life satisfaction.
In other findings, attendance (17)______religious services was associated with(18)______psychological distress,(19)______ among young and middle-aged adults, and increased life satisfaction among young and old adults. Service attendance was also associated with higher (20)______health among all age groups.
